This week, the PGA TOUR heads to Harbour Town Golf Links for the RBC Heritage tournament on Hilton Head Island. Masters champion Jon Rahm, THE PLAYERS champion Scottie Scheffler and World No. 5 Max Homa will add to their limited history at Harbour Town. Rahm’s only appearance came in 2020 while Scheffler will be making his tournament debut. Jordan Spieth returns to the RBC Heritage to defend his title from a year ago. He will be hoping to continue his solid recent form after a T4 finish at Augusta National last week. Patrick Cantlay, who Spieth defeated in a playoff to win in 2022, will also be back in the field. Cantlay has four top-10s in five appearances at Harbour Town, including three top-three finishes. Meanwhile, Justin Thomas will be looking to come back strongly after missing the cut at the Masters Tournament. He has two finishes of 11th or better in four appearances at RBC Heritage.
